Mô tả công việc Technical Solutions Lead
About the Role
You will be the technical link between customers and our engineering and manufacturing teams. You will clarify product needs, assess feasibility, guide design-for-manufacturing discussions, coordinate technical decisions, and help move opportunities from early engagement towards new product introduction and production.
Key Responsibilities
• Lead technical discussions with customers to understand application needs, product requirements, performance targets, and manufacturing constraints.
• Coordinate technical reviews, RFQ assessments, feasibility studies, customer meetings, and project kick-offs.
• Work with design, process, production, quality, commercial, and supplier teams to evaluate manufacturability, process capability, yield, cost, risk, and scalability.
• Present technical options and trade-offs clearly, align stakeholders on decisions, and drive follow-up actions to closure.
• Support new product introduction, customer qualification, and transfer-to-production activities, including resolution of cross-functional technical issues.
• Capture customer feedback and relevant market needs, then translate them into product improvements or technology roadmap recommendations.
• Travel internationally when required for customer visits, supplier discussions, technical workshops, project reviews, or manufacturing support.
Essential Qualifications • Bachelor's degree, Engineer's degree, or an equivalent tertiary qualification in engineering or applied science. Candidates with strong equivalent practical experience will also be considered. Relevant fields may include optics/photonics, physics, mechanical, materials, manufacturing, electrical/electronics, mechatronics, automation, or a related discipline. • Relevant experience in at least one technical area such as applications or customer engineering, product/process/manufacturing engineering, NPI, technical project leadership, quality engineering, or operations engineering. • Experience in a relevant manufacturing environment such as optics/optoelectronics, precision components, electronics, semiconductor packaging, automotive sensing, medical devices, or another high-precision industry. • Working knowledge of design for manufacturing and how design choices can affect process capability, yield, cost, quality, and product performance. • Strong analytical problem-solving skills and the ability to lead technical workstreams or projects. Formal people-management experience is not required. • Working proficiency in both Vietnamese and English is required. The incumbent must be able to conduct technical discussions in Vietnamese and communicate with international stakeholders in English through meetings, emails, presentations, and reports. • Comfortable working with customers, suppliers, and cross-functional teams across cultures and time zones, and willing to travel when required. Preferred Qualifications • Direct exposure to micro-optics or precision optics products such as micro lens arrays, Fresnel lenses, wafer-level optics, or precision molded optics. • Familiarity with one or more manufacturing processes such as mastering, tooling, replication, molding, imprinting, coating, dicing, stacking, assembly, inspection, or optical metrology. • Experience supporting RFQ, feasibility assessment, NPI, customer qualification, or transfer-to-production activities. • Practical use of quality and manufacturing tools such as process control, FMEA, control plans, capability studies, root cause analysis, or corrective action. • Additional proficiency in Chinese (Mandarin), Japanese, or Korean is highly valued.
